Scope
This part specifies the technical requirements for the manufacturing, testing, inspection and acceptance of oxygen-controlled austenitic stainless steel forgings for pressurized water reactor nuclear power plant core supports and upper support plates. This section applies to 022Cr19Ni10N oxygen-controlled austenitic stainless steel forgings for core supports and upper support plates in pressurized water reactor nuclear power plants.
